Personal data Aron Samuel 

  • He was born on August 20, 1838 in Rijssen,Gemeente Rijssen-Holten,Overijssel.Source 1
    [Bron:-Erfgoed Rijssen-Holten]

    Akte # 60 Rijssen 22-08-1838

    Uur van geboorte 12 uur 's middags
  • He died on February 17, 1913 in Rijssen,Gemeente Rijssen-Holten,Overijssel, he was 74 years old.Source 2
    Bron Burgerlijke stand - Overlijden

    Archieflocatie Historisch Centrum Overijssel
    Algemeen Toegangnr: 123
    Inventarisnr: 11209
    Gemeente: Rijssen
    Soort akte: overlijdensakte
    Aktenummer: 16
    Aangiftedatum: 17-02-1913
    Overledene Aron Samuel
    Geslacht: M
    Overlijdensdatum: 17-02-1913
    Leeftijd: 74
    Overlijdensplaats: Rijssen
    Vader Aron Samuel
    Moeder Rebekka de Lange
    Partner Betje Troostwijk
    Relatie: weduwnaar
    Nadere informatie geboren te Rijssen

    Joodse Begraafplaats Arend Baanstraat Rijssen

    Grafsteen tekst
    Aron Samuel
    weduwnaar van
    Betje Troostwijk
    overleden 10 Adar I// 17 febr: 5673
    Vertaling Hebr. tekst
    En Aharon stierf daar.
    Hier Rust
    de heer Aharon, zoon van de heer Shmu'eel.
    Hij stierf op maandag 10 Adar I en werd
    begraven op dinsdag 11 Adar I van het
    jaar 5673.
    T.N.Ts.B.H.

Household of Aron Samuel

He is married to Betje Troostwijk.

They got married on May 8, 1867 at Rijssen,Gemeente Rijssen-Holten,Overijssel, he was 28 years old.Source 4

Bron Burgerlijke stand - Huwelijk
Archieflocatie Historisch Centrum Overijssel
Algemeen Toegangnr: 123
Inventarisnr: 11022
Gemeente: Rijssen
Soort akte: Huwelijksakte
Aktenummer: 4
Datum: 08-05-1867
Bruidegom Aron Samuel
Leeftijd: 28
Geboorteplaats: Rijssen
Bruid Betje Troostwijk
Leeftijd: 33
Geboorteplaats: Zwolle
Vader bruidegom Aron Samuel
Moeder bruidegom Rebekka de Lange
Vader bruid Benedictus Troostwijk
Moeder bruid Esther de Lange
Nadere informatie beroep Bg.: koopman; beroep vader Bg.: koopman; beroep vader Bd.: koopman

Child(ren):

  1. Samuel Samuel  1868-1935

  • The couple has common ancestors.

  • Notes about Aron Samuel

    Echtgenote (Betje Troostwijk) is ook zijn nicht
